Infineon and Skeleton collaborate on solid-state transformers and sidecars to enhance AI data-center resilience

InfineonAI / LLMData Center
Infineon Technologies AG of Munich, Germany and Skeleton Technologies, which provides high-power energy storage systems for AI data centers, have signed a memorandum of understanding (MoU) to collaborate on high-efficiency, resilient power solutions for modern data centers...
